JS 語法簡單記錄一點

if((this).hasClass(‘gray2’)){ (this).removeClass(‘gray2’).addClass(‘blue’);
var p_Id = $(this).val(); 取出當前的值 class=“?”
array_product.push(p_Id); js數組添加

            }else{
                $(this).removeClass('blue').addClass('gray2');
                var p_Id = $(this).val();
                **array_product.splice($.inArray(p_Id,array_product),1); //刪除數組中的某個值**
            }

$(this) 表示當前項 each中使用

var renderContent=function(comboName,list){
            var str='';
            for(var i in list) {
                var item = list[i];
                if (item.pItemRelatedProductInstance.pName == undefined) {
                    str = str + renderItem('請添加產品');
                } else{
                    str = str + renderItem(item.pItemRelatedProductInstance.pName);
                }
            }//***************************  html 字符串
            var content=
            '<div class="asset-list">'+
            '<h3>'+comboName+'</h3>'+
            '<ul>'+
                str +
            '</ul>'+
            '<div class="jcb-btn-box jcb-btn-single ">'+
            '<button class="btn btn-sure">推送資產</button>'+
            '</div>'+
            '</div>'+
            '<div class="gap"></div>';
            return content;
        }
        __.ajax("/api/manager/myaccount/getallcomboassets",{"managerId":1}, function (result) {
            console.log(result);
            var c=result.params;
            var con='';
            for(var x in c){
                var item=c[x];
                //for 循環 item.list 就是拿出item中的list
                con=con+renderContent(item[0].comboItemRelatedAssetPackInstance.comboName,item);
            }
            //把這個字符串放到那個裏面***************
            $('#combo-assets-list-majie').append(con);
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章